Mike Conan
Mike Conan is the author of The Greatest Treasure: The Life-Changing Riches of God’s Seven Attributes. He has served as the pastor for over 25 years in a wide range of ministry settings-including Gig Harbor, Redmon, Port Orchard, the Los Angeles area, and the Portland area. For 15 of those years, Mike served as the lead pastor, helping churches grow in gospel-centered teaching, discipleship, and mission
